Study on the Control Measure to Dispersion of Commensal Rodentsat Demolished Area in City
Zhu Long-biao*; Zhu Hong; Li Ling-di; ey al
Abstract1059)      PDF (92KB)(585)      
In order to know the rodent control measure at demolished area and prevent the dispersion of commensal rodents, we measured the change of rodent density around the demolished area by using scene investigation test in which test zone and contrast zone had been set.The procedures included principal rodent control measure of chemical killing and one or two rodent defence zone, with clip method, powder track method and feeding method for detecting rodent density.The results showed that:(1) If rodent control measure taken before pulling down, the damage caused by rodent around the demolished area decreased evidently.The positive rate of rodent track around the contrast zone increased 5.07 times with powder track method, and the positive rate of feeding method increased 3.98 times.(2) If rodent control measure taken and rodent defence zone set, the rodent density around the zone decreased 29.80 percent, though the rodent density of the contrast zone increased 5.16 times.(3) If rodent control measure taken two times and rodent defence zone set, the damage caused by the rodent around the zone decreased 66.24 percent, comparing to taking rodent control measure one time and with rodent defence zone.If we take two times killing measure and set defence zone before pulling down, not only the dispersion of commensal rodent at the demolished area can be entirely controlled, but also the damage caused by the rodent around the area can be decreased.

Determination on Amounts of Feeding, Water Drinking and Energy Intakeof Rattus norvegicus and Rattus niviventer confucianus
Hu Yi-zhong Du; Wei-guo; Jin Wei-xing; et al
Abstract1075)      PDF (99KB)(698)      
Amounts of feeding, water drinking and energy intake were compared between Rattus norvegicus and Rattus niviventer confucianus in this paper.We conducted the experiment in April, 1997,and used rice and peanut as diet.Results showed that the mean daily amounts of feeding, water drinking and energy intake on per kilogram of body weight were higher in Rattus niviventer confucianus than in Rattus norvegicus.The interspecific differences may be explained by the fact that Rattus niviventer confucianus resides in more complex habitant than Rattus norvegicus.
The Mice LD 50 Determination and Rodent Control Field Tests with Botulinum Type C
Li Shu-yang*; Zhang Zeng-ju*; Wu Xi-jin; et al
Abstract1110)      PDF (85KB)(573)      
The paper reported the Mice LD 50 determination and Rodent control field tests with Botulinum Type C.The LD 50 were 0.0891±0.0473 ml/kg by 25℃ for 48h; 0.1363±0.0597 ml/kg by 30℃ for 48h;0.1712±0.0652ml/kg by 35℃ for 48h.The Botulinum Type C was powerful for rodent control.In the field tests with rice baits, the killing rate by the Botulinum Type C was 91.08%; 89.41% and 88.04%.It was showed that the Botulinum Type C fit in with the South China.
Inhibitory Effects of Deltamethrin(DM) on the Proliferation of Aedes albopictus C6/36 Cell Line and Regeneration of Inhibitied Cells
Lu Xiao-li; Zhao Tong-yuan; Xue Rui-de; Lu Bao-lin
Abstract1190)      PDF (106KB)(608)      
In this paper,the C6/36 cell growth rate and karyokinesis, after adding the DM(10μg/ml、20μg/ml、40μg/ml) on culture, were dynamic observed using ictus method for revealing the effects of DM on C6/36 cell line proliferation.The inhibitory effects of higher DM on the cell line proliferation and a doseresponse effects were observed.The inhibited cells were regenerated after recession of DM treatment on the cell line.It was showed inhibitory effects of DM on the proliferation of C6/36 cell was reversible.
Comparative Study on Soluble Protein in Culex fatigans Larvae and Pesticides-Resistant Larvae in Guizhou
Xiong Mei-hua; Zou Ya-ding; Xu Li-na; et al
Abstract1050)      PDF (104KB)(648)      
To determine protein component, specific protein molecular from normal larvae, pesticidesresistant larvae of Culex fatigans and evaluation of the specific insecticideresistance protein bands.Soluble proteins of the late Ⅲinstar and the early Ⅳinstar larvae of both normal and pesticidesresistant mosquito were prepared.Protein component bands were tested by SDS-PAGE.The normal larvae of Culex fatigans contained mainly 12 protein bands, the 55 and 50KDa were particular protein molecular, and insecticide-resistance larvae to Malathion and Deltamethrin present at 15 and 17 protein bands respectively.The 66KDa that stronger and clearer protein bands was recognized by resistance larvae only.It could be one of the main proteins to cause mosquito larvae resistance.
Study on the Delimitation of Zoogeographical Regions in Hubei, on the Basis of Mosquitoes Fauna
Li Jian; Yang Zhen-qiong; Liu Yi-ren
Abstract991)      PDF (143KB)(636)      
In the present paper,the writers attempt to deal with the problem of the delimitation of the boundaries of zoogeographical regions in Hubei on the basis of the mosquitoes fauna of the province.Among the 11 genera and 72 species of mosquitoes listed,53 species (or 73.6%) belong to the species entirely or mainly distributed in the oriental region, 11 species (or 15.3%) to those entirely or mainly distributed in the palaearctic region, and 8 species (or 11.1%) to those distributed in both oriental and palaearctic region.Basing on the comparison of the mosquito fauna of the adjacent provinces, including Hunan, Jianxi and Henan, the writers suggests that Hubei province should be included in the oriental region but the North-Western part, lying north of 32° N latitude of the province be included in the palaearctic region.

Mosquitoes Control with Clarias fuscus in the Poolsat the Constructing Sits in Urban Area
Xu Bao-hai; Zheng Zu-jie; Xu Long-jie; Xu Long-shan; et al
Abstract1215)      PDF (89KB)(692)      
During recent years, the investigation revealed that the pool amounts at constructing sites were significantly breeding in urban area.The paper reported a result of the mosquito control with Clarias fuscus wich was introduced from Egypt in 1994-1995.A fish about 10g or 12cm long can catch 1200 larvae of Culex pipiens quinquefasciatus;a fish of 500g can catch 26000 larvae at least for one day Before putting in the fish, the average larvae density was 465 worms/spoon (350ml), the biting rat was 147 times/m.h in night at the trial area where there were 37 pools about 2000m 2 at a underground constructingsite.Since putting in Clarias fuscus, the densities of larvae and adults were descended quickly and the pools wer not found with mosquito breeding after a week.The average biting rat was 16/m.h at the area where no constructing sites.RPI were 0.013 and 0.095 in the area of trial and contrast.The result shown the densities of larvae and adult mosquitoes was descended 98.7% and 90.5% respectively. Claria fuscus were growing well in the breeding sits and can survive in winter in Fuzhou.The result showed the fish is a good natural enemy to mosquito.
A New Species of Helina R.-D.from China (Diptera: Muscidae)
Sun Jin-zhong; Sun Bao-ye; Ma Zhong-yu
Abstract1074)      PDF (91KB)(613)      
Helina yushuensis sp.nov.(figs.1-3)Male Body length 8.0-9.5mm.It is similar to the species Helina hirtifemorata Malloch, 1926, but differing from the latter with frons wider, about 1.5 times the distance between posterior ocelli inclusive; mid femur with a complete row of pv;mid tibia with 1 ad, 3(5) p; hind femur only with short hairs on ventral surface.Holotype ♂, Yushu County, Qinghai Province, July 13.1981, collected by Sun Baoye, paratypes 4 ♂♂, same as holotype.The types are deposited in the Health & Anti-Epidemic Station of Liaoning Province.

A New Species of Miltogramma ( Cylindrothecum) from LiaoNing, China(Diptera: Sarcophagidae)
Zhang Lian-fu; Liu Jie
Abstract1108)      PDF (89KB)(596)      
Miltogramma ( Cylindrothecum) curticlaws sp.nov.(figs 1-3) ♂:Body length 5.5-6mm.Eyes bare, similar to Miltogramma ( Cylindrothecum) ibericum (Vill., 1912).But differs from the latter with the new soecies body length 5.5-6mm, interfrontalia gold, palpi yellow, t 2 1 v, 1 pd, 1 p and.It is also quite different in the male Phallosome (as shown in the figures).Holotype ♂, Jianchang (Mt.Daheishan), Liaoning province, August 10,1995,collected by Liu Jie, aiiotype♀, paratype 7 ♂♂,5 ♀♀,same as holotype, the type specimens are preserved in the Health and Anti-Epidemic Station of Chaoyang, Liaoning Province.
One New Blackflies of Simulium ( Gomphostilbia) from Qingdao Laoshan, Shan Dong, China(Diptera:Simuliidae)
Ren Bing*; An Ji-yao; Kang Zeng-zuo
Abstract1133)      PDF (145KB)(541)      
One new blackfly, Simulium ( Gomphostilbia) laoshanstum sp.nov.were described on the female, male, pupal and larval specimens collected from Laoshan, Qingdao, Shandong province, China.All the specimens are kept in the Medical Entomology Collection Gallery, Academy of Military Medical Sciences, Beijing.This new species closely related to S.( G.) pingxiangense An and Hao, 1990 from Pingxiang, Guangxi province, China and S.( G.) ela Davies, 1987 from Sri Lanka and S.( G.) sundaicum Edwards, 1934 from East Java, however, it is clearly different from S.( G.) pingxiangense An and Hao, 1990, S.( G.) ela Davies, 1987 and S.( G.) sundaicum Edwards, 1934 by the structure of gonapophysis, genital fork, cibarium of the female and median sclerite, paramere of the male, by the branching of the pupal respiratory filaments and form of postgenal cleft in the mature larvae.Holotype ♀, paratype 3♂, 4 pupa, 3 mature larvae, Qingdao Laoshan, Shandong, 45m(36.3°N, 120.5°E) 18 May,1994.

Biological Diversity of Blood-sucking Dipteran Insects
Yan Zhong-Chen; YU Yi-xin
Abstract910)      PDF (101KB)(728)      
The present paper deals with diversity of blood-sucking insects (mosquitoes and biting midges et al) by analysing the data obtained from most parts in China during 1987~1988.All the data were summarized in table 1~3.The results of the present study may be summarized into 2 main points: 1.The probability of interspecific encounter (PIE) index was lower in northern region than in southern region.2.The species numbers in southern region was more than that in northern region, and species′ dominant degree was higher in northern region than in southern region.

Investigation on Species Composition and Distribution of Cockroachesin Urban Environment in Guangdong Province
Du Xiao-feng; Lin Li-feng; Liang Yong-ang; et al
Abstract1217)      PDF (193KB)(638)      
It was reported that 8 species of cockroaches were examined in urban environment of Guang province.The cockroaches infested 52.09% of all types of houses inevetigated, and Periplaneta americana was the most important species in the area.The distribution and living habits of cockroaches were also discussed.
A Survey of Ixodoidea Distribution in NingXia
Li Zhi-gang; Ma Fu-hai; Wu Mei-yun; et al
Abstract1075)      PDF (69KB)(614)      
Ixodoidea have been known 2 families 6 genera and 18 species in Ningxia.In Which 1 genera (Rhipicephalus Koch) and 4 species ( Ixodes persulcatus schulze, Ixodes ovatus Neumann, Hacmaphysalis concinna Koch, Rhipicephalus sanguineus Latreille) are new record, 141 ticks were collected in Liupan Mountain, 68.8% were Ixodes persulcatus schulze, which is the predominant species in above place.In accordancc with distribution on the faunisties and regionalization of insects, ticks in Ningxia are distributed on three insect regions (Ⅰ~Ⅲ) and three insect subregions(Ⅲ 1~Ⅲ 3).
Preliminary Study on Leptotrombidium ( L.) subpalpale as Spreading Medium of HFRS
She Jian-jun*; Zhang Yun Huang; Chong-an; et al
Abstract1107)      PDF (105KB)(652)      
The results of the epidemiological investigation showed that Leptotrombidium ( L.) subpalpale was distributed mainly in the focis of wild rat type HFRS, which was a dominant species in this area, the constituent rate was 60.34%.The density of larva was higher in November and December.It's geographic distribution was correlated with the HFRS cases distribution in the focis, and the Apodemus agrarius, main infections resources of HFRS, bore high 314.83 (November) and 239.75 (December) of chigger mite index.From the L.(L.)subpalpale larva collected from HFRSV antigen positive rats and from the L.(L.)subpalpale larva captured with small blackboards, and then bited the mice infected with HFRSV, we isolated one HFRSV strain for each, which confirmed that L.(L.)subpalpale be subject to HFRSV and that forms the determined factor for L.(L.)subpalpale as the vector of HFRS.
First Isolation of Rickettsia Tsutsugamushi from Leptotrombidium Palpalis
Liu Yun-xi; Wu Qin-yong; Sun Hai-long; et al
Abstract903)      PDF (115KB)(600)      
This article reported the isolation of Rickettsia tsutsugamushi ( Rt.) from Leptotrombidium palpalis in China for the first time.4 strains were obtained from 4 groups of chiggers (71-150 chiggers as a group).Enlargement of liver was observed in experimented mice inoculated with isolates, but the spleen′s enlargement was rarely observed.Serological identification of 4 strains revealed strong positive reaction with Rt.(Gilliam strain).More research was needed to confirm whether L.palpalis can act as a vector of Rt.from chiggers to rodents or from chiggers to men.
